Milwaukee Braves @ Philadelphia Phillies

1957-06-15 Β· Day game Β· Shibe Park Β· Att: 12178 Β· 2:41

Milwaukee Braves defeated Philadelphia Phillies 7–2. Milwaukee Braves put up 2 in the 5th. Bob Buhl earned the win. Del Rice went 3-for-5 with 1 HR and 2 RBI.
